Identify the leak water leaks often occur because of pinholes in your plumbing system or small failures in caulking or other exterior materials
Water takes the easiest path to the ground, so it will often travel along the framing in the walls If unsure, use a moisture meter to determine if your home's moisture levels are within normal parameters Use an infrared camera to look for leaks.
